Here are some tips on how to increase the efficiency of your refrigerator:-

1. Learn how to set the correct temperature:- Ideally, set the temperature between 37 and 40 degrees Fahrenheit. This is the right temperature that can prevent bacteria from growing without spoiling food that doesn't freeze well. So always check the temperature. 2. Clean the engine condenser coil regularly:- The refrigerator has a lot of problems because the condenser coil is very dirty. If dirt and dust particles collect there, the refrigerator cannot process the hot air properly. As a result, the machine consumes more energy to keep the internal temperature of the refrigerator stable and low.

3. Check the rubber seal on the refrigerator door:- Make sure it is fully functional when sealing the door. Cold air cannot come out. To find out if it actually works when sealing the fridge, insert a piece of paper. If you can pull unhindered, the rubber seal is not working properly.
